VISUAL DESCRIPTION
In this historical advertisement, we see the Percival Proctor flying over an illustrated map of India, reflecting both geographical context and intended market outreach. With registration VT-PAC indicating Indian registry, this particular model was marketed towards post-World War II aviation needs on the subcontinent. The ad copy speaks to a future where air networks will connect cities across vast distances efficiently—a nod to India's expansive geography—and positions the Proctor as an ideal solution for regional transport requirements due to its practicality and economy.
